If ln(a)=2, ln(b)=3, and ln(c)=5, evaluate the following: ln(a^-4/b^1 c^1)

Ln ( a^(-4) / b^1  c^1 ) =
= ln a ^(-4) - ( ln b + ln c ) =
= - 4 ln a - ln b - ln c =
= - 4 * 2 - 3 - 5 =
= - 8 - 3 - 5 = - 16
